Zhuangzi (Stanford Encyclopedia of Philosophy) First published Sat Nov 10, 2001 ‘Zhuangzi’ is the name of the second foundational text of the Daoist philosophical and religious tradition and the name of the putative author of this text, who early historical sources say flourished between about 350 and 300 B.C.E.
